Palestinian Foreign Ministry Calls for Urgent International Action to Halt Israeli Occupation Crimes


Doha: The Palestinian Ministry of Foreign Affairs today renewed its call for the international community to take urgent and effective action, compelling the Israeli occupation to halt its aggression on the West Bank, including occupied Jerusalem, amidst ongoing crimes and the systematic destruction of means of life, and to achieve a sustainable ceasefire in Gaza Strip.



According to Qatar News Agency, in a statement, the ministry noted that the occupation is committing the crime of forced displacement of more than 30,000 Palestinian citizens from their homes, along with the demolition of infrastructure, destruction of homes, and altering the features of Palestinian camps. It also highlighted the military incursions into Palestinian towns, camps, and cities across the West Bank, which are accompanied by destruction, tampering with homes, terrorizing civilians, including children and women, arbitrary mass arrests, and the stripping of basic civil freedoms, including the freedom of movement within their own land, in the ugliest forms of colonial apartheid systems.



The ministry called on the international community to take strong and genuine action to halt the ongoing aggression against the Palestinian people, stressing that mere condemnations or expressions of concern are insufficient, pointing out that international silence on these crimes encourages the occupation to persist in committing further atrocities and provides it with the time needed to complete its ethnic cleansing, displacement, and annexation crimes.
